§ 43-38-619 — Election or appointment of officers

The board of directors shall elect or appoint, in a manner set forth in the articles or bylaws or in a resolution approved by the affirmative vote of a majority of the directors present, a president, secretary and any other officers or agents the board of directors considers necessary or desirable for the operation and management of the cooperative. These officers and agents have the powers, rights, duties, responsibilities, and terms of office provided for in the articles or bylaws, or as determined by the board of directors.
